Metal edging isn’t just for industrial designs or urban facades—it’s now a versatile exterior finishing staple that transforms residential fronts. Whether crafted from stainless steel, aluminum, copper, or zinc, metal gives lasting appeal with minimal upkeep. Here’s what makes metal edging a standout choice:
- Sleek Modern Aesthetic: Clean lines and reflective surfaces elevate your curbline with a polished, contemporary look.
- Weather Resistance: Metal withstands rain, snow, UV rays, and temperature shifts far better than wood or vinyl, holding its luster years longer.
- Low Maintenance: No annual sealing or repainting—just occasional cleaning to keep your metal edging gleaming.
- Versatile Styles: From minimalist straight lines to custom-cut curves, metal options adapt seamlessly to any architectural style.

Practical Tips for Choosing the Right Metal Edging
- Match Your Home Style: Sleek aluminum suits minimalist homes; ornate copper adds warmth to historic exteriors.
- Consider Durability: Stainless steel is ideal for coastal or high-moisture areas.
- Professional Installation: Properly integrated metal edging ensures longevity and prevents gaps or rust.
- Color and Finish: Whether matte, brushed, or polished, choose finishes that complement your home’s palette.
